Oligonucleotide duplex stability controlled by the 7-substituents of 7-deazaguanine bases

Stichwörter: | Chemistry; Chemistry, Medicinal; Chemistry, Organic; DNA; Pharmacology & Pharmacy | Erscheinungsdatum: | 1995 | Herausgeber: | PERGAMON-ELSEVIER SCIENCE LTD | Enthalten in: | BIOORGANIC & MEDICINAL CHEMISTRY LETTERS | Band: | 5 | Ausgabe: | 24 | Startseite: | 3049 | Seitenende: | 3052 | Zusammenfassung: | Oligonucleotides containing 7-substituted 7-deazaguanine residues (7-methyl, 7-iodol have been synthesized. The self-complementary octamer d(I(7)c(7)G-C)(4) containing 7-iodo-7-deaza-2'-deoxyguanosine forms a stabilized duplex compared to the parent oligomer d(G-C)(4) (Delta T-m = 10 degrees C). Also the complex between the oligodeoxynucleotide d(I(7)c(7)G(5)-G) and poly(C) is stabilized (Delta T-m = 10 degrees) over that of d(c(7)G(5)-G) with poly(C). |
